Understanding Blockchain Technology
Blockchain is a decentralized digital ledger that records transactions across many computers in a way that makes it nearly impossible to alter the record. The technology was first introduced in 2008 as part of the Bitcoin network, and its secure and transparent nature quickly made it a powerful tool for a wide range of applications, including cryptocurrency.
In simple terms, blockchain is like a chain of blocks that holds data. Each block contains a batch of transactions, and once a block is full, it’s added to the blockchain in a linear, chronological order. The decentralized nature of blockchain means that no single entity controls the data. This makes it resistant to fraud, censorship, and hacking.
Cryptocurrencies: Digital Money Powered by Blockchain
Cryptocurrencies are digital currencies that operate using blockchain technology. Bitcoin, the first cryptocurrency, is a prime example of how blockchain facilitates the transfer of digital money. Cryptocurrencies rely on blockchain to function because the blockchain provides a secure and transparent way of tracking transactions without the need for intermediaries like banks.
For example, when you send Bitcoin from one wallet to another, the transaction is recorded on the Bitcoin blockchain. The blockchain acts as a public ledger, ensuring that all transactions are transparent, verified, and immutable. It also ensures that users cannot double-spend or create fraudulent transactions, which is a critical feature for digital money.
The Role of Blockchain in Cryptocurrency
Blockchain technology plays a crucial role in the functioning of cryptocurrencies. Here’s how:
- Security: Blockchain uses cryptographic techniques to secure transactions. This ensures that each transaction is validated by multiple participants (or nodes) in the network, making it incredibly difficult to hack or alter the information.
- Transparency and Trust: Since blockchain is public and decentralized, all transactions can be viewed by anyone on the network. This transparency builds trust among cryptocurrency users and ensures accountability in the system.
- Decentralization: Unlike traditional financial systems, cryptocurrencies are not controlled by a central authority like a bank or government. Blockchain’s decentralized nature allows cryptocurrencies to be free from the control of any single entity, giving users more control over their funds.
- Immutable Ledger: Once a transaction is added to the blockchain, it cannot be changed or deleted. This immutability prevents fraud and provides a reliable record of all transactions made on the network.
- Efficient Peer-to-Peer Transactions: With blockchain, cryptocurrencies enable fast and low-cost transactions between users without the need for intermediaries. This peer-to-peer transfer of assets allows for quicker, cheaper, and more efficient global payments.

Blockchain and Cryptocurrency Case Study: Bitcoin
Bitcoin, the first cryptocurrency, is the perfect example of how blockchain and cryptocurrencies work together. When Bitcoin was introduced in 2008, it provided a decentralized digital currency that could be transferred over the internet without the need for banks or central authorities.
Every Bitcoin transaction is recorded on the Bitcoin blockchain, which serves as an immutable ledger of all transactions. The decentralized nature of Bitcoin’s blockchain means that no one person, government, or institution controls it. This makes Bitcoin resistant to censorship and gives users greater freedom to transact without interference.
As the Bitcoin network has grown, so has the understanding of how blockchain can support digital currencies. Other cryptocurrencies like Ethereum, Litecoin, and Ripple (XRP) have followed in Bitcoin’s footsteps, creating their own blockchains and providing additional use cases, such as smart contracts and decentralized applications (dApps).
